Skip to main content
Shift4Shop Installation

Learn how to add RaveCapture to your Shift4Shop Store

Updated over 3 months ago

Overview

This article will help you install RaveCapture on your Shift4Shop Store. 

Connecting RaveCapture & Shift4Shop

The first step is to add RaveCapture to your Shift4Shop store. This requires copying & pasting a few items of code into your store, which is mentioned below. 

Note:  You will need to be logged into your RaveCapture account and within the Integrations > Shift4Shop area, to obtain the code to paste into your Shift4Shop Store.

Step 1:  Add RaveCapture Rest API

Within your Shift4Shop store, you will need to do the following: 

  • Click Modules 

  • Type in "rest" in the search bar at the top 

  • Click "Settings" for the REST API item

Once within the REST API Apps area, the next step is to add RaveCapture: 

  • Click Add, on the top right

  • Enter in your Public Key.  You can obtain this from the Shift4Shop Integrations area in RaveCapture, labeled "Public Key

  • Once entered, click Save

You should now see "RaveCapture" listed under Application Name.

Step 2:  Add RaveCapture - Order New Webhook URL to Shift4Shop

Within your Shift4Shop store, you will need to do the following: 

  • Click Modules 

  • Type in "webhooks" in the search bar at the top 

  • Click "Settings" for the Webhooks item

Once within the Webhooks area, the next step is to add RaveCapture: 

  • Click Add Webhook, on the top right

  • Enter the Webhook URL for "Order New".  You can obtain this from the Shift4Shop Integrations area in RaveCapture, labeled "Order New Webhook URL".

  • For the Webhook name enter:   RaveCapture Order New

  • For the Format set to: JSON

  • For the Event set to:  Order New

  • Make sure the checkbox is selected "Enabled"

  • Once you're all set click "Save" on the top right

Step 3:  Add RaveCapture - Order Status Change URL to Shift4Shop

Within your Shift4Shop store, you will need to do the following: 

  • Click Modules 

  • Type in "webhooks" in the search bar at the top 

  • Click "Settings" for the Webhooks item

Once within the Webhooks area, the next step is to add RaveCapture: 

  • Click Add Webhook, on the top right

  • Enter the Webhook URL for "Order Status Change".  You can obtain this from the 3DCart Integrations area in RaveCapture, labeled "Order Status Change Webhook URL".

  • For the Webhook name enter:   RaveCapture Order Status Change

  • For the Format set to: JSON

  • For the Event set to:  Order Status Change

  • Make sure the checkbox is selected "Enabled"

  • Once you're all set click "Save" on the top right

After you've finished adding both Webhooks, you should see the following under the Webhooks > Settings page.

Step 4:  Set Order Status & Secure URL

The last step of the integration is to set your order status and copy & paste your Secure URL into RaveCapture. The following items need to be configured from within your RaveCapture account under Integrations > Shift4Shop. 

The Order Status can be set to: 

  • Shipped

  • New

When an order is set to this status, the data is sent to RaveCapture to begin the review process once your send delay is met. 

The Secure URL is your store URL including the "https", the URL should look like this: 

Once that's done, click on "Save Settings", and you're done! 

Have a question or need support on this integration? 

Please contact our support team via our live chat or support@ravecapture.com

Did this answer your question?